Meaning of deambulation | Babel Free

Noun CEFR C1
/diːæmbjuːˈleɪʃən/

Definitions

  1. A walking abroad; a promenading.
    obsolete
  2. An instance of deambulation; a trip, journey, peregrination, itineration, or pilgrimage.
